Content:
When a safari hunting ivory offends an African tribe, they are captured and tortured. One man is released without weapons or clothing, to be hunted in a life or death race.
Note:
Aspect ratio 2.35:1, 16:9 widescreen. - New, restored high-definition digital transfer. - Orig.: Südafrika, USA 1966. - Enth. audio commentary by film scholar Stephen Prince "John Colter's Escape", a 1913 written record of the trapper's flight from Blackfoot Indians — which was the inspiration for "The naked prey" — read by actor Paul Giamatti ; original soundtrack cues created by director Cornel Wilde and ethnomusicologist Andrew Tracey, along with a written statement by Tracey ; a booklet featuring a new essay by film critic Michael Atkinson and a 1970 interview with Wilde
